Responsibilities
  • Plan and manage the production schedule and AIT workflows, including developing routings and work-instructions (SOPs) for the satellite‑electronics programmes.
  • Drive continuous‑improvement (Lean, Six‑Sigma) across the production floor and AIT labs to increase throughput, reduce re‑work and improve first‑time‑right rates.
  • Coordinate cross‑functional teams – design, procurement, quality, test and logistics – to resolve bottlenecks, technical issues and configuration changes.
  • Maintain accurate production data, risk registers and status reporting using MES/ERP and AIT‑specific tools
  • Ensure compliance with ESA/UK‑Space Agency standards (ECSS, ISO‑9001) and programme‑specific configuration‑control processes.
  • Train junior planners, technicians and new hires on production processes, AIT procedures and data‑entry standards.
  • Work with Quality Assurance to embed in‑process inspections, non‑conformance (NC) tracking and closure.
  • Ensure AIT activities meet required certification test sequences
